<feed xmlns='http://www.w3.org/2005/Atom'>
<title>ports/lang/python310, branch main</title>
<subtitle>FreeBSD ports tree</subtitle>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/'/>
<entry>
<title>lang/python310: pull in upstream commits addressing webbrowser.open() issue</title>
<updated>2026-04-06T02:18:16+00:00</updated>
<author>
<name>Charlie Li</name>
<email>vishwin@FreeBSD.org</email>
</author>
<published>2026-04-06T02:18:16+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=cc746eedc4dfcefe29d13fe3c36d29e7fa8b48f5'/>
<id>cc746eedc4dfcefe29d13fe3c36d29e7fa8b48f5</id>
<content type='text'>
Security: 9fdad262-2e0f-11f1-88c7-00a098b42aeb
PR: 294246
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Security: 9fdad262-2e0f-11f1-88c7-00a098b42aeb
PR: 294246
</pre>
</div>
</content>
</entry>
<entry>
<title>devel/libtextstyle, devel/gettext*: Update to 1.0</title>
<updated>2026-03-31T13:52:28+00:00</updated>
<author>
<name>Tijl Coosemans</name>
<email>tijl@FreeBSD.org</email>
</author>
<published>2026-03-31T11:30:41+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=d7a065627cebe93f700d85c8dc605e32074ba886'/>
<id>d7a065627cebe93f700d85c8dc605e32074ba886</id>
<content type='text'>
devel/gettext-tools: Use external libunistring and libxml2.

lang/python*: Remove dependency on gettext-tools.  It isn't used and
it is gettext-tools that depends on python now.

PR:		293963
Exp-run by:	antoine
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
devel/gettext-tools: Use external libunistring and libxml2.

lang/python*: Remove dependency on gettext-tools.  It isn't used and
it is gettext-tools that depends on python now.

PR:		293963
Exp-run by:	antoine
</pre>
</div>
</content>
</entry>
<entry>
<title>lang/python310: update to 3.10.20</title>
<updated>2026-03-03T17:33:18+00:00</updated>
<author>
<name>Charlie Li</name>
<email>vishwin@FreeBSD.org</email>
</author>
<published>2026-03-03T17:33:18+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=51c9343f6d1e94cf85be15b2d55f35f51f8a880d'/>
<id>51c9343f6d1e94cf85be15b2d55f35f51f8a880d</id>
<content type='text'>
Changelog: https://docs.python.org/release/3.10.20/whatsnew/changelog.html

Security: bfe9adc8-0224-11f1-8790-c5fb948922ad
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Changelog: https://docs.python.org/release/3.10.20/whatsnew/changelog.html

Security: bfe9adc8-0224-11f1-8790-c5fb948922ad
</pre>
</div>
</content>
</entry>
<entry>
<title>lang/python310: pull in upstream commits addressing vuxml entries</title>
<updated>2026-01-26T04:59:26+00:00</updated>
<author>
<name>Charlie Li</name>
<email>vishwin@FreeBSD.org</email>
</author>
<published>2026-01-26T04:59:26+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=82836aacdcd2c9246bc896598ed0e453d5ab4c1a'/>
<id>82836aacdcd2c9246bc896598ed0e453d5ab4c1a</id>
<content type='text'>
Security: 613d0f9e-d477-11f0-9e85-03ddfea11990

Event: Winter Field Day 2026
PR: 291609
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Security: 613d0f9e-d477-11f0-9e85-03ddfea11990

Event: Winter Field Day 2026
PR: 291609
</pre>
</div>
</content>
</entry>
<entry>
<title>Revert "Reapply "lang/python31[012]: deprecate 2026-03-31""</title>
<updated>2026-01-03T23:08:48+00:00</updated>
<author>
<name>Antoine Brodin</name>
<email>antoine@FreeBSD.org</email>
</author>
<published>2026-01-03T23:08:48+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=ac6809aadf8da7bf3288fbfcadde21f253cc20b6'/>
<id>ac6809aadf8da7bf3288fbfcadde21f253cc20b6</id>
<content type='text'>
This reverts commit a132acab8736bad2fa59e941d5d77da4ea7688a0.
This commit is disrespectful for people trying to make the ports tree work with version 3.12

With hat:	pkgmgr
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This reverts commit a132acab8736bad2fa59e941d5d77da4ea7688a0.
This commit is disrespectful for people trying to make the ports tree work with version 3.12

With hat:	pkgmgr
</pre>
</div>
</content>
</entry>
<entry>
<title>Reapply "lang/python31[012]: deprecate 2026-03-31"</title>
<updated>2026-01-03T22:58:29+00:00</updated>
<author>
<name>Matthias Andree</name>
<email>mandree@FreeBSD.org</email>
</author>
<published>2026-01-03T22:58:29+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=a132acab8736bad2fa59e941d5d77da4ea7688a0'/>
<id>a132acab8736bad2fa59e941d5d77da4ea7688a0</id>
<content type='text'>
This reverts commit 666108a04abc08a18791425f967b26357dd4d96d.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This reverts commit 666108a04abc08a18791425f967b26357dd4d96d.
</pre>
</div>
</content>
</entry>
<entry>
<title>Revert "lang/python31[012]: deprecate 2026-03-31"</title>
<updated>2026-01-03T22:55:27+00:00</updated>
<author>
<name>Charlie Li</name>
<email>vishwin@FreeBSD.org</email>
</author>
<published>2026-01-03T22:55:27+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=666108a04abc08a18791425f967b26357dd4d96d'/>
<id>666108a04abc08a18791425f967b26357dd4d96d</id>
<content type='text'>
The latest 3.12 release contains the referenced security fixes. The
other two branches are not EOL.

PR: 291609
With hat: python
Requested by: antoine

This reverts commit 66173037774d8648a59e30b424692ae80dbc20b3.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The latest 3.12 release contains the referenced security fixes. The
other two branches are not EOL.

PR: 291609
With hat: python
Requested by: antoine

This reverts commit 66173037774d8648a59e30b424692ae80dbc20b3.
</pre>
</div>
</content>
</entry>
<entry>
<title>lang/python31[012]: deprecate 2026-03-31</title>
<updated>2026-01-03T22:42:02+00:00</updated>
<author>
<name>Matthias Andree</name>
<email>mandree@FreeBSD.org</email>
</author>
<published>2026-01-03T22:39:35+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=66173037774d8648a59e30b424692ae80dbc20b3'/>
<id>66173037774d8648a59e30b424692ae80dbc20b3</id>
<content type='text'>
Since the current Python upstream maintainers have not yet released
security fix releases to match 3.14.2 and 3.13.11, meaning that we have
about three unfixed security issues per 3.12/3.11/3.10 release, and the
current FreeBSD python@ team is unwilling to take approved upstream
patches individually (see PR), we need to expedite the removal of
vulnerable versions and the transition to 3.13/3.14.  Deprecate all
"security support" releases of Python that are not in the bugfix phase.

PR:		291609
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Since the current Python upstream maintainers have not yet released
security fix releases to match 3.14.2 and 3.13.11, meaning that we have
about three unfixed security issues per 3.12/3.11/3.10 release, and the
current FreeBSD python@ team is unwilling to take approved upstream
patches individually (see PR), we need to expedite the removal of
vulnerable versions and the transition to 3.13/3.14.  Deprecate all
"security support" releases of Python that are not in the bugfix phase.

PR:		291609
</pre>
</div>
</content>
</entry>
<entry>
<title>lang/python310: deprecate and expire in 11 months</title>
<updated>2025-11-01T17:23:20+00:00</updated>
<author>
<name>Matthias Andree</name>
<email>mandree@FreeBSD.org</email>
</author>
<published>2025-11-01T15:23:48+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=b9de19c42879a5ce3282bbe54f92812fe07554ae'/>
<id>b9de19c42879a5ce3282bbe54f92812fe07554ae</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>lang/python310: Update to 3.10.19</title>
<updated>2025-10-12T01:36:19+00:00</updated>
<author>
<name>Wen Heping</name>
<email>wen@FreeBSD.org</email>
</author>
<published>2025-10-12T01:36:19+00:00</published>
<link rel='alternate' type='text/html' href='http://cgit.freebsd.org/ports/commit/?id=53082011b7d9b815e3492a47e0c78ea565da97a4'/>
<id>53082011b7d9b815e3492a47e0c78ea565da97a4</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
</feed>
